That is about the going rate at most shops $90-100 for 3 pulls dyno time is not cheap.

Originally Posted by drewbroo
I did my pulls in 4th, maybe that explains my results.....
HP is close to the same (within 2-3 of third gear) torque will read slightly higher in 4th

Originally Posted by drewbroo
4th, its closest to 1:1
Third is 1.18 4th is 0.89 both are about 15% off of 1.00:1 makes only a couple HP difference either way.

Originally Posted by Sweetsandman
And remember to do 3rd gear this time! I'll probably be going to the track because they probably won't be doing any dyno runs that late.
3rd gear will make about A +1% difference in HP so 3 whp or so no big deal. 4th is better if you are loging data and checking for knock on the street.
As long as you get a baseline and new numbers using the same gear you are fine.

P0091
Fuel Pressure Regulator Solenoid 1 Control Circuit Low Voltage
Reply
Old Jun 12, 2009 | 09:53 PM
  #220  
steven6870's Avatar
Senior Member
iTrader: (1)
 
Joined: 10-06-08
Posts: 801
Likes: 1
From: NC
^^^Yep thats it. Instant limp mode. Like I stated above, I simply untaped the wiring to the sensor, pulled the wire off the the bracket that is wrapped around the pump, retaped the wiring, and replugged the sensor. Turned it over once, then cranked it the second time, and it went away. I took it the dealer to make sure the pump was still operating properly, and they pulled the code, and said it works fine. Car drive fine now, havent seen the code since, and I have WOT the car a decent amount.
